Switch to Eclipse mars.2

Format all non generated classes to get ride of formatter
incompatibilities
Migrate checkstyle config for checkstyle 6.19

Change-Id: I8c2b31765053a3686de62320f893bedf4ad81d1f
Signed-off-by: Mathieu Cartaud <mathieu.cartaud@obeo.fr>
768 files changed